Community Spotlight
A Uintah High School teacher is in the news again for being a standout educator in the state of Utah. Uintah High teacher and DECA advisor Kami Elison has been recognized as the CTE Teacher of the Month for the state of Utah. Uintah High School shares that Elison teaches nine to 11 career and technical education (CTE) courses from business communications to web development to TV broadcasting in any given school year. Kristina Yamada, an education specialist with the Utah State Board of Education, shares that “what sets Kami apart is not just her technical proficiency but also her unwavering commitment to her students’ development.” This is not the first time Elison has been recognized as a dynamic educator. She was named the 2022-2023 Teacher of the Year for Uintah School District, has received a Best In State award twice for her students’ performance on the Business Communications 1 exam, and is a finalist for Utah’s Teacher of the Year. Congratulations to Kami Elison on the latest of many deserved accolades.
